Indians invite LHP Chris Narveson to Major League Camp

The Cleveland Indians today announced the following roster moves relative to the Spring Training roster:
 
Signed free agent LHP CHRIS NARVESON to a Minor League contract with a non-roster invitation to Major League spring training camp.
 
Narveson, 35, owns a career Major League record of 30-19 with a 4.71 ERA in 118 games/65 starts over eight Major League seasons with St. Louis, Milwaukee and Miami. The Charlotte, NC native posted double-digit win totals with the Brewers in 2010 and 2011 and was the second round pick (53rd overall) of the St. Louis Cardinals in 2000 First-Year Player Draft.
 
He split the 2016 season in the Miami Marlins organization and was a member of Miami's Opening Day roster. At Triple-A New Orleans he limited left-handed batters to a .218 (26/119) average against and posted a 3.60 ERA in 15 starts (80.0IP, 69H, 32ER).
